Police have responded to community concern about people on release orders not complying
It appears more people in the Niagara region are getting fed up with people arrested for a crime not complying with release orders.
In response to these community concerns, the NRP started focusing on people disobeying court orders.
During December and January, police followed up on seven individuals, all from Niagara, ranging in age from 27 to 50, all were arrested and charged for not complying.
